Innovative AirMaster EVO fan for livestock houses now available across Asia

Improve climate control and thus optimise livestock productivity in egg and meat production.
calendar icon 10 August 2022
clock icon 3 minute read

With AirMaster EVO, Big Dutchman has recently launched an innovative fan across Asia which significantly reduces energy consumption up to 70%*. The fan is ideal for tunnel ventilation environments in brand-new pig and poultry houses – it is however also suitable as a retrofit replacement for aging fans. Besides energy expenditures, the AirMaster EVO is poised to improve climate control and thus optimise livestock productivity in egg and meat production.

Drawing from Big Dutchman’s in-depth expertise in ventilation dynamics, as well as building engineering, the AirMaster EVO provides a perfect balance of air moving capacity, energy efficiency and air flow ratio. This results in uniform ventilation with lower power consumption even in high pressure environments, delivering uninterrupted and precise climate control.

Evolved from the successful line of the V130/140 fan series, the next generation AirMaster EVO comes in a three or six-blade configuration to meet specific ventilation needs. It is built tough with glass fibre reinforced blades for maximum operational durability. Die-casting of the V-belt pulley and blade hub as a single aluminium piece also means less maintenance and longer lasting performance.

An overview of the advantages:

Energy savings up to 70 %

The efficient IE3 inverter motor makes all the difference when it comes to energy efficiency.

  • Compared to traditional ON/OFF fans that draw more energy with every stop-start cycle, the AirMaster EVO features a variable speed inverter motor that can adjust the fans’ speed according to ventilation requirements.
  • This significantly reduces energy consumption up to 70%* in most applications, by minimising wasted energy. In fact, the motor often only runs at a top capacity of 60% as it does not need to make up for lost energy.

Uniform, high-pressure performance

  • Built to work under pressure of up to 110pa*, the AirMaster EVO is engineered for pressure stability, performing efficiently even if in-house static pressure is high. A comprehensive test of the fan’s performance stability has been conducted by the independent Bess Lab of the University of Illinois, USA.
  • Aside from the ability to deliver uniform airflow throughout the production house, the AirMaster EVO also ensures consistent ventilation for optimum animal comfort when connected to the ViperTouch Dynamic Multistep control system.

Robust, proven design

  • The AirMaster EVO carries on the philosophy of simple yet durable construction. In fact, Big Dutchman has sold over 70,000* fans of the same construction all across Asia since 2015.
  • The high-quality galvanised steel structure with glass-fibre reinforced blades and pre-tensioned V-belt are all proven to perform year after year.

*based on internal data of number of AirMaster V130/140 sold in Asia since 2015.

Return on investment

  • No doubt an initial investment is required to upgrade your ventilation system with the AirMaster EVO. However, the savings in power consumption will pay for the use of this fan many times over its operational lifetime.
  • You can expect a return-on-investment within 2.5 years*, or even shorter depending on the local power tariff in your country. Combined with regular preventive maintenance the AirMaster EVO will provide many years of worry-free use. This results in continuous investment returns, along with the added advantage of improved overall performance.

*ROI calculation is an average based on prevailing local power tariffs in Asia. Figure will also differ depending on climate condition at installation site.
